Govt examining proposal to notify new tourism areas in J&K: Javid Ahmad Dar

JAMMU, FEBRUARY 12: Minister for Agriculture, Javid Ahmad Dar Thursday informed the House that the government is examining a proposal regarding the notification of new tourism-worthy areas across Jammu and Kashmir, including several prominent locations in Bani Constituency like Bani town, Lowang and Sarthal.

The Minister, as per an official statement, stated this while replying to a question on behalf of Chief Minister Omar Abdullah raised by Legislator Dr. Rameshwar Singh in the House.

Responding to a supplementary question, the Minister stated that the government is committed to take all necessary steps to strengthen the tourism infrastructure across Jammu division. He added that efforts will be made to establish rest houses and tourist huts at key tourist destinations to enhance facilities for the visitors and promote sustainable tourism.

The Minister further informed that, under the direction of Chief Minister Omar Abdullah, a Winter Carnival was conducted on 8 February, 2026 at Bani as part of the government’s broader initiative to promote tourism development in the region. He added that the event was held to showcase the natural beauty, cultural heritage and tourism potential of the area.

The Minister reiterated government’s commitment towards exploring and developing new tourist destinations to boost local economy, generate employment and position Jammu and Kashmir as a premier travel destination.
